San Diego Music Awards 2005 Winners List (September 16, 2005)

Album of the Year: Louis XIV “The Best Little Secrets Are Kept”

Best New Artist: Get Back Loretta

Artist of the Year: As I Lay Dying

Lifetime Achievement Award (artist): The Farmers (Rolle Love, Jerry Raney, Buddy Blue, Joel Kmak)

Lifetime Achievement Award (music industry): Al Guerra

Song of the Year: Pinback, “Fortress”

Best Pop Album: Ryan Ferguson, “Three Four”

Best Rock Album: Reeve Oliver, “Reeve Oliver”

Best Hip-Hop Album: Deep Rooted, “In the Beginning”

Best Alternative Album: Goodbye Blue Monday, “Help is on the Way”

Best Punk Album: Hot Snakes, “Audit in Progress”

Best Hard Rock Album: The Locust, “Safety Second, Body Last”

Best Blues Album: Candye Kane, “White Trash Girl”

Best Jazz Album: Fattburger, “Work to Do”

Best Americana Album: The Coyote Problem, “The Wire”

Best Local Recording: Anya Marina, “Miss Halfway”

Best Jazz: Jaime Valle

Best Acoustic: Tristan Prettyman

Best Blues: Lady Dottie & the Diamonds

Best World Music: B-Side Players

Best Americana: Eve Selis

Best Hip-Hop: Alfred Howard & the K23 Orchestra

Best Country: Whiskey Tango

Best Pop: Steve Poltz & the Rugburns

Best Alternative: Pepper

Best Punk: The Plot to Blow Up The Eiffel Tower

Best Rock: Dirty Sweet

Best Hard Rock: Underminded

Best Electronic: Square Circle

Best DJ: Scooter

Best Cover or Tribute Band: Rockola

All Access (registration required): She said she'd do it a few months ago and she's gone ahead and done it: Rep. LOUISE SLAUGHTER (D-NY) has introduced an LPFM bill to get rid of third-adjacent-channel interference protection rules, the "Enhance and Protect Local COmmunity Radio Act of 2005." The BUFFALO-area legislator and ranking minority member of the House Rules Committee announced the bill at this week's FUTURE OF MUSIC COALITION summit; the bill joins a similar bill making its way through the Senate, sponsored by Sen. JOHN MCCAIN (R-AZ).
